Had a lovely two hour drive through the mountains to get to Spoleto. This hilltop town is the first on my list for the region of Umbria. I’ve never been to this region before so everything I see will be new!
Spoleto was a bit on the cool side as the wind had nothing to stop on top of the hill. Getting to the top was much, much easier than I thought it was going to be. A short walk and, bless their souls, the town had put a series of escalators almost all the way to the top! Sitting on the top of the hill is Rocca Albornozlana.
The Rocca held a collection of local religious items and old frescos. Each room also had an explanation of its previous use when it was an active fort.




















After touring the fort I started down to the rest of the town. Got stopped a bit by a road race the town was holding for the kids of the town.
